What is multi-digit multiplication?
Back
Multi-digit multiplication is the process of multiplying numbers that have more than one digit, such as 23 × 45.

What is the distributive property in multiplication?
Back
The distributive property states that a(b + c) = ab + ac, allowing us to break down complex multiplication into simpler parts.

How do you multiply a number by 10, 100, or 1,000?
Back
To multiply by 10, 100, or 1,000, you add zeros to the end of the number. For example, 23 × 10 = 230.

How can you check your multiplication answer?
Back
You can check your multiplication answer by using the inverse operation, which is division.

What is an array in multiplication?
Back
An array is a visual representation of multiplication using rows and columns, helping to understand the concept of groups.
